Market Square in Cracow
It is a symbol of Cracow, definitely one of the biggest and most beautiful medieval market squares in Europe. It attracts tourists with incredible atmosphere, monuments and entertainment.
Over the Royal Market Square there is St. Mary’s Church (Kosciól Mariacki), actually a basilica) which contains a masterpiece of late-Gothic art, the carved high altar created by Wit Stwosz (1477-89). In order to have a closer look at it one needs to buy a ticket. From the church’s main tower there is a trumpet call, the hejnal mariacki, sounded every hour. The Market Square is dominated by the Cloth Hall which has remained a market hall in today’s terms. One can buy or see beautiful, typically Polish goods here. In the Market there is the best known in Poland Adam Mickiewicz Monument, a meeting place for people. From the 70-metre Town Hall Tower situated in the Square one can see a wide panorama of the city, whereas inside there is a branch of the Historical Museum of Cracow. Nowadays the 14th century Tower is the only remnant of the City Hall. In the Square there are also small tenement houses with rich history which add charm to this place. Many of them are homes of joints and open-air cafes.
